Question: Scenario 78: What does a green circle with a white truck symbol inside indicate to a Class 3 driver?

Answer options: ✅ A designated truck route

  • No trucks allowed
  • Trucks must yield
  • Truck parking ahead

Correct answer: A designated truck route

Explanation: A green circle with a white truck symbol indicates a designated truck route, directing commercial vehicles to specific roadways. This sign helps manage traffic flow and reduce impact on residential areas. The correct answer is "A designated truck route".
